class PluginDescription(java.lang.Comparable[PluginDescription]):
    """
    Class to hold meta information about a plugin, derived from meta-data attached to
    each :obj:`Plugin` using a :obj:`@PluginInfo <PluginInfo>` annotation.
    """

    class_: typing.ClassVar[java.lang.Class]

    @staticmethod
    @typing.overload
    def createPluginDescription(pluginClass: java.lang.Class[typing.Any], status: PluginStatus, pluginPackage: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str], category: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str], shortDescription: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str], description: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str]) -> PluginDescription:
        """
        Constructs a new PluginDescription for the given plugin class.
         
        
        Deprecated, use :obj:`@PluginInfo <PluginInfo>` instead.
        
        :param java.lang.Class[typing.Any] pluginClass: the class of the plugin
        :param PluginStatus status: the status, UNSTABLE, STABLE, RELEASED, DEBUG, or EXAMPLE
        :param java.lang.String or str pluginPackage: the package to which the plugin belongs (see :obj:`PluginPackage`
                subclasses for examples)
        :param java.lang.String or str category: the category to which the plugin belongs (see :obj:`PluginCategoryNames`
        :param java.lang.String or str shortDescription: a brief description of what the plugin does
        :param java.lang.String or str description: the long description of what the plugin does
        :return: the new (or cached) PluginDescription
        :rtype: PluginDescription
        """

    @staticmethod
    @typing.overload
    @deprecated(", use PluginInfo instead.")
    def createPluginDescription(pluginClassParam: java.lang.Class[typing.Any], status: PluginStatus, pluginPackage: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str], category: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str], shortDescription: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str], description: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str], isSlowInstallation: typing.Union[jpype.JBoolean, bool]) -> PluginDescription:
        """
        Constructs a new PluginDescription for the given plugin class.
        
        
        .. deprecated::
        
        , use :obj:`@PluginInfo <PluginInfo>` instead.
        :param java.lang.Class[typing.Any] pluginClassParam: the class of the plugin
        :param PluginStatus status: the status, UNSTABLE, STABLE, RELEASED, DEBUG, or EXAMPLE
        :param java.lang.String or str pluginPackage: the package to which the plugin belongs (see :obj:`PluginPackage`
                subclasses for examples)
        :param java.lang.String or str category: the category to which the plugin belongs (see :obj:`PluginCategoryNames`
        :param java.lang.String or str shortDescription: a brief description of what the plugin does
        :param java.lang.String or str description: the long description of what the plugin does
        :param jpype.JBoolean or bool isSlowInstallation: true signals that this plugin loads slowly
        :return: the new (or cached) PluginDescription
        :rtype: PluginDescription
        """

    def getCategory(self) -> str:
        """
        Return the category for the plugin.
        
        :return: the category
        :rtype: str
        """

    def getDescription(self) -> str:
        """
        Return the description of the plugin.
        
        :return: ``"<None>"`` if no description was specified
        :rtype: str
        """

    def getEventsConsumed(self) -> java.util.List[java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.PluginEvent]]:
        ...

    def getEventsProduced(self) -> java.util.List[java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.PluginEvent]]:
        ...

    def getModuleName(self) -> str:
        """
        Return the name of the module that contains the plugin.
        
        :return: the module name
        :rtype: str
        """

    def getName(self) -> str:
        """
        Return the name of the plugin.
        
        :return: the name of the plugin.
        :rtype: str
        """

    def getPluginClass(self) -> java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]:
        """
        Return the class of the plugin.
        
        :return: plugin class object
        :rtype: java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]
        """

    @staticmethod
    def getPluginDescription(c: java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]) -> PluginDescription:
        """
        Fetches the :obj:`PluginDescription` for the specified Plugin class.
         
        
        If the PluginDescription is found in the static cache, it is returned directly,
        otherwise a new instance is created (using annotation data attached to the Plugin
        class) and it is cached for later use.
        
        :param java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in] c: Plugin's class
        :return: :obj:`PluginDescription`
        :rtype: PluginDescription
        """

class PluginUtils(java.lang.Object):
    """
    Utility class for plugin-related methods.
    """

    class_: typing.ClassVar[java.lang.Class]

    def __init__(self):
        ...

    @staticmethod
    def assertUniquePluginName(pluginClass: java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]):
        """
        Ensures the specified Plugin has a unique name among all Plugin classes
        found in the current ClassSearcher's reach.
        
        :param java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in] pluginClass: Class
        :raises PluginException: throws exception if Plugin class is not uniquely named
        """

    @staticmethod
    def forName(pluginClassName: typing.Union[java.lang.String, str]) -> java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]:
        """
        Returns the Class for a Plugin, by class name.
        
        :param java.lang.String or str pluginClassName: String class name
        :return: Class that is a Plugin, never null.
        :rtype: java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]
        :raises PluginException: if specified class does not exist or is not a Plugin.
        """

    @staticmethod
    def getDefaultProviderForServiceClass(serviceClass: java.lang.Class[typing.Any]) -> java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]:
        """
        Returns the Plugin Class that is specified as being the defaultProvider for a
        Service, or null if no default provider is specified.
        
        :param java.lang.Class[typing.Any] serviceClass: Service interface class
        :return: Plugin class that provides the specified service
        :rtype: java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]
        """

    @staticmethod
    def getPluginNameFromClass(pluginClass: java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in]) -> str:
        """
        Returns the name of a Plugin based on its class.
        
        :param java.lang.Class[ghidra.framework.plugintool.Plugin] pluginClass: Class to get name from
        :return: String name, based on Class's getSimpleName()
        :rtype: str
        """

    @staticmethod
    def instantiatePlugin(pluginClass: java.lang.Class[T], tool: ghidra.framework.plugintool.PluginTool) -> T:
        """
        Returns a new instance of a :obj:`Plugin`.
        
        :param java.lang.Class[T] pluginClass: Specific Plugin Class
        :param ghidra.framework.plugintool.PluginTool tool: The :obj:`PluginTool` that is the parent of the new Plugin
        :return: a new Plugin instance, never NULL.
        :rtype: T
        :raises PluginException: if problem constructing the Plugin instance.
        """
